Charities Repurpose Festival Waste to Aid Homeless

Emmaus Hertfordshire and Herts for Refugees collected 260 discarded tents and 150 sleeping bags from the Isle of Wight Festival to aid the homeless and promote environmental sustainability, marking their fourth year of collaboration in this initiative.

Financial Crisis Looms for Hamburg's Club and Festival Scene

A survey of 56 Hamburg club and festival operators reveals that roughly one-third of venues face closure, while visitor numbers are down 7.9%, though profits are down 12.6%. Rising costs and rents are cited as the main challenges.

Japanese Umbrellas: Spiritual Vessels and Cultural Symbols

Japanese umbrellas, beyond weather protection, serve as spiritual vessels ("yorishiro") attracting gods and spirits, a belief reflected in festivals and folklore like kasa yokai (umbrella spirits), demonstrating a unique cultural and spiritual significance.

Natural Fibers Tested to Reduce Mud at Wacken Open Air

At the Wacken Open Air festival, a 200-meter test area uses natural fiber mats made of sedges, moor grasses, and coconut fibers to improve ground stability and reduce mud, potentially revolutionizing sustainable festival grounds and contributing to climate protection.

Increased Costs Force Cancellation of 25 East Anglian Festivals

The Cambridge Folk Festival, along with 24 other East Anglian festivals, was canceled in 2025 due to increased costs and inflation, resulting in a £320,000 loss for the Cambridge event in 2024 and significantly impacting local musicians and the regional economy.
